Mechanical reliability and tactile feedback Mechanical switches are the backbone of this keypad’s performance. With a range of switch options—such as linear, tactile, or clicky—users can tailor the keystroke feel to their preference and task. The mechanical construction delivers consistent actuation, reduced key wobble, and longer lifespan compared to membrane alternatives. For anyone who spends long hours entering data, coding APIs, or mapping macros, the tactile certainty of each keystroke can translate into meaningful gains in accuracy and speed.
Macro capabilities and customization A core advantage of macro mechanical keypads is their ability to store and execute multi-key sequences with a single press. This can streamline repetitive tasks, such as data entry, repetitive coding scaffolding, and complex spreadsheet operations. With software that supports profile management, users can create, save, and switch between macro sets tailored to distinct workflows—whether they’re parsing datasets, shader compilation, or rapid prototyping in design software.

Use cases across professions – Data entry and financial modeling: Quick numeric input paired with macros for repetitive calculations. – Software development: Shortcuts for compiling, testing, and navigating IDEs, plus macros for boilerplate code generation. – Digital content creation: Macros to apply consistent formatting, batch rename assets, or automate export pipelines. – Engineering and design: Rapid key sequences for simulations, CAD toggles, or material property adjustments.
Choosing the right model When selecting a 21-key mechanical numeric keypad, consider: – Switch type: Determine whether you prefer linear, tactile, or clicky feedback based on tolerance to fatigue and preference for audible cues. – Backlight customization: Ensure software controls are accessible to tailor color profiles and macro mappings. – Connectivity: USB wired models provide consistent latency; verify compatibility with your operating system and devices. – Build and keycap quality: Look for double-shot or PBT keycaps and a sturdy frame to withstand heavy use. – Software ecosystem: A robust companion app for creating and organizing macros can dramatically improve workflow efficiency.
